🎨 How to color it

Layer the mermaid’s hair in deep teal, her shell top in pearly lavender, the crystal reefs in icy blue, and the small fish in flashes of gold. Use sharp colored pencils for the many triangles in her tail and fin, turning the page as needed so each tiny facet gets a clean edge. For a luminous twist, blend darker blues at the crystal bases and leave a few bubble circles nearly white, as if they caught underwater light.

Every dusk, Ianthe trimmed slivers of mica from the prism reef and fitted them into little triangles on a slate board, listening to the soft clink of stone against shell. She wanted a game no tide had ever carried in: one made by her own patient hands, where fish could score points by flashing through paths of light. Until one day, the moon-current rolled in early and lifted every piece at once.

Because of that, her careful board became a drifting constellation. Because of that, the reef fish began swimming through the scattered shards, and each turn of their bodies cast a new rule across the water—silver, violet, then green. Ianthe followed, palms gritty with mica dust, and set the pieces not back where they had been, but where the light wanted them.

At last the first round began without a board at all. The reef chimed, the bubbles shone like small moons, and Ianthe felt the quiet pride of a maker seeing her invention breathe. Every dusk after, she trimmed slivers of mica and listened for that soft clink of stone against shell.
